Wingecarribee Galleries and Museums
Galleries, museums, and historical venues are some of the most interesting and enriching places to visit in and around the Wingecarribee region of New South Wales, Australia. There are so many amazing places to explore, each with its own unique charm and character.
Galleries:
1. BDAS Gallery: Located in Bowral, the BDAS (Bowral and District Art Society) Gallery showcases some of the finest artwork by local artists in a range of mediums, including oil, acrylic, watercolor, and mixed media.
2. Sturt Gallery: This gallery is a must-visit for anyone interested in contemporary craft and design. Located in Mittagong, Sturt Gallery features an ever-changing selection of works by Australia's most talented designers and craftspeople.
3. Bowral Art Gallery: This gallery is situated in the heart of Bowral and showcases an impressive range of artwork by local artists. Visitors can enjoy a diverse selection of paintings, sculptures, and ceramics.
Museums:
1. The Coach House Museum: Located in Berrima, The Coach House Museum offers a fascinating glimpse into the region's past. Visitors can explore exhibits showcasing the history of the region, including displays of early farming and transportation equipment.
2. Bradman Museum and International Cricket Hall of Fame: A must-visit for cricket fans, this museum is dedicated to the life and career of the legendary cricketer Sir Donald Bradman. Located in Bowral, the museum features exhibits on Bradman's early life, his triumphs on the cricket field, and his influence on the sport.
3. Berrima District Historical Society Museum: This museum offers a fascinating insight into the history of the Berrima district, including exhibits on early settlement and the gold rush period. Visitors can also view collections of photographs, artifacts, and documents.
Historical venues:
1. Berrima Gaol: This historic gaol, located in the heart of Berrima, offers a glimpse into the harsh realities of prison life in the 19th century. Visitors can explore the cells, exercise yards, and punishment areas, as well as view exhibits on the gaol's history.
2. Harper's Mansion: Built in the mid-19th century, Harper's Mansion is a grand colonial homestead located in Berrima. Visitors can explore the mansion's beautifully restored rooms and gardens, as well as view exhibits on the history of the property.
3. Bowral and District Historical Society Museum: This museum, located in the Old Police Station in Bowral, offers a fascinating glimpse into the history of the Bowral region. Visitors can explore exhibits on early settlement, farming, transport, and industry, as well as view collections of photographs and artifacts.
